为什么编程不建议用锐龙
-
编程不建议使用锐龙主要有以下几个原因:
-
性能差异:相比于英特尔的处理器,锐龙处理器在单线程性能上稍逊一筹。对于某些需要高单线程性能的编程任务,如游戏开发或图形处理等,使用锐龙处理器可能会导致性能下降。
-
兼容性问题:锐龙处理器在一些编程环境中可能存在兼容性问题。例如,一些编程工具、库或框架可能不完全适配锐龙处理器,导致无法正常运行或出现异常。这可能会增加开发和调试的难度。
-
缺乏相关支持:相比于英特尔处理器,锐龙处理器在编程领域的支持相对较少。这意味着你可能无法获得与锐龙处理器相关的专业技术支持,或者无法获得适用于锐龙处理器的最新编程工具和技术。
-
软件优化问题:由于市场份额相对较小,一些软件开发者可能没有对锐龙处理器进行充分的优化。这可能导致在使用锐龙处理器时,软件的性能无法达到最佳状态。
然而,需要注意的是,以上问题并不是绝对的。在某些特定的编程场景中,锐龙处理器可能表现出与英特尔处理器相当甚至更好的性能。因此,在选择使用何种处理器时,应根据具体的编程需求和环境来进行评估和选择。
1年前 -
-
编程中不建议使用锐龙(AMD Ryzen)的原因有以下几点:
-
单线程性能较差:尽管锐龙处理器在多线程性能上表现出色,但在单线程性能方面却相对较差。在某些编程场景下,单线程性能是至关重要的,因为并非所有任务都可以被有效地并行化。在这种情况下,使用性能更强大的处理器可能会更加高效。
-
兼容性问题:锐龙处理器的兼容性相对较差,特别是在一些旧的软件和驱动程序方面。有些编程工具和框架可能无法完全适应锐龙的硬件特性,导致一些功能无法正常工作或出现性能问题。
-
缺少一些特定的编程工具和库:由于锐龙处理器的市场份额较小,一些特定的编程工具和库可能没有针对锐龙进行优化。这可能导致在使用这些工具和库时性能不佳或功能受限。
-
散热问题:由于锐龙处理器的设计和制造工艺,其功耗较高,导致散热要求较高。在编程过程中,特别是在进行大规模计算和编译等任务时,处理器可能会过热,影响性能和稳定性。
-
市场竞争的影响:市场上存在多种处理器选择,包括英特尔(Intel)的处理器。由于英特尔处理器在编程领域的历史和市场份额较大,相关的编程工具和库通常会更好地支持和优化英特尔处理器。因此,在选择处理器时,考虑到市场上的竞争和支持情况也是一个因素。
需要注意的是,以上仅是一些常见的原因,是否使用锐龙处理器还需要根据具体的需求和情况进行评估。在某些场景下,锐龙处理器可能仍然是一种不错的选择。
1年前 -
-
标题:为什么编程不建议使用锐龙处理器?
引言:锐龙处理器是一款由AMD推出的处理器产品,具有高性能和多核心的特点,适合进行多线程和多任务处理。然而,在编程领域中,使用锐龙处理器可能会面临一些问题和挑战。本文将从方法、操作流程等方面进行讲解,解答为什么编程不建议使用锐龙处理器的问题。
一、不稳定性问题
1.1 温度过高:由于锐龙处理器的高性能和多核心设计,其在运行过程中会产生较高的热量,导致温度升高。如果编程任务比较复杂或者程序代码存在一些问题,会导致处理器过载,进而导致温度过高,可能会引发系统崩溃或者重启。1.2 频率波动:锐龙处理器在运行过程中,由于温度和电压等因素的影响,其频率可能会出现波动。这种频率波动会导致程序的运行时间不稳定,影响编程任务的完成效率。
二、兼容性问题
2.1 操作系统兼容性:锐龙处理器在某些操作系统上的兼容性可能不够完善,可能会导致编程环境的不稳定。尤其是在使用一些特殊的编程工具和框架时,可能会遇到兼容性问题,影响编程的开展。2.2 软件兼容性:某些编程软件或者库在设计时可能针对Intel处理器进行了优化,而对AMD处理器的支持不够完善。这就导致了在使用锐龙处理器进行编程时,可能会遇到某些软件无法正常运行或者性能不佳的问题。
三、性能问题
3.1 单线程性能:虽然锐龙处理器在多线程处理方面表现出色,但在单线程性能上可能相对较弱。对于一些单线程运行较为频繁的编程任务,锐龙处理器的性能可能不如Intel处理器。3.2 编译器优化:某些编程语言的编译器在设计时可能更多地考虑了Intel处理器的优化,而对AMD处理器的优化不够充分。这就导致了在使用锐龙处理器进行编程时,可能会遇到编译器优化不足的问题,影响程序的运行效率。
结论:尽管锐龙处理器具有高性能和多核心的特点,但在编程领域中,由于其不稳定性、兼容性和性能等问题,建议使用Intel处理器进行编程。当然,这并不是说锐龙处理器完全不能用于编程,而是需要在选择处理器时,综合考虑编程任务的需求和处理器的特点,选择最适合的处理器进行编程工作。
1年前